Why do we need to restart the CRM server after registering the custom workflow using Plugin Registration tool to make that work properly - workflow

Can we have any alternative way to make run-able the custom Workflow activity in Workflow steps.
All the time what I do is register the dll using Plugin registration tool and then restart the server. Then only we can use the custom workflow activity on Workflow.
I have tried after restarting the IIS and hoping so it'll be done but no luck.
All the time restarting server should not be any solution. Is there any alternative way for it please suggest. All you are suggestion would be greatly appreciated.

1) You do not need to restart IIS; restart the application pool (its far faster and doesn't disrupt other applications that might be running on the server; by default its the 'CrmAppPool') using the command:
%systemroot%\system32\inetsrv\appcmd recycle apppool CrmAppPool
2) Similarly, you can recycle the async process by running (powershell):
Restart-Service -displayname "Microsoft Dynamics CRM Asynchronous Processing Service"
3) Both of these commands can be run remotely using the powershell command:
powershell Invoke-Command [CrmServerName] -ScriptBlock { ["Restart-Service...."] }

CRM caches the dlls, restarting the services causes it to refresh those caches.
If you register a synchronous plugin then you need to reset IIS.
If you register an asynchronous plugin or custom workflow activity you need to reset the asynchronous service.

The point here is very specific -
It's not only true for the CRM, but is also true for any web application hosted on IIS. Web App (CRM for you case) caches dlls for the very first time when the message is executed (plugin message/event - Although this is done by .net platform internally, so to address the other similar calls more efficiently.). So, in that case you need to flush off the synced thing from your web app. And that is why you need to recycle app pool (SMART WAY -> for single application flush, and without impacting other applications on the server, you should always go for APPPOOL Recycle instead to IIS restart.)
For this, what I would suggest you is to write a powershell script to recycle AppPool for your application and trigger it on Post build event of your project (plugin project) in VS. So, that will make your process automated and will reduce your efforts to much lesser.
Regarding custom WF assembly, Since it executes under Async. Service, so you need to discard off the cached content from here as well.

You shouldn't need to restart anything.
What you need to do is increment the build number of the assembly you are updating each time you deploy it.
This makes sure that CRM knows not to use it's cached version but to load the updated one the database

If you want to see the CWAs without any need of restarts just select the activity in the plugin registration tool and press the "save" button below the properties

Updating Deployments SCCM

I'm super new to SCCM and trying out some stuff.
Atm I create a lot of Applications to deploy on around 50 Clients.
Before I deploy them to all clients I test them on a test Client.
The problem now is that if I change sth in the Deployment Type like the installation command I have to delete the deployment everytime afterwards and deploy it again or the change wont happen on the client when I install the Application next time.
There probaly a way easier method which I can't figure out atm.
So how do i update the changes I made after the Application is allready deployed?
Greetings,
Paxz.
The application deployment command line will only be executed if the application is not detected - i.e. the Application Detection criteria evaluates to false. With this premise, it is possible to change the Application Detection criteria so it evaluates to false... perhaps add an addition rule to include "file1.txt exists"? This should work, but it is ugly and I would not recommend it.
A better approach
I prefer to test my application deployments on VMs in the first instance: prepare the destination machine, snapshot it, then deploy.
If you need to tweak your deployment you can then make the required changes, redistribute the content (if required), then restore the VM's snapshot for a fresh deployment.
I managed to get an answer from microsofts technet forum.
For deployments to know the update in the command line, I just have to push the next policy polling cycle.
This will only be effective for clients that haven't executed the deployment type yet.
Other than that there seems to be no other way than deleting the deployment and re-deploying it for the changes to be known for the deployment.

Is Quartz.Net appropriate to run a long process started from an ASP.Net 3.5 page?

I have a long running task (many hours) that is started via a web page on an intranet interface. This is an ASP.Net 3.5 project. Of course, I could extend the script timeout and let the page run for several hours, but I don't think this is a clean solution. I read somewhere that long running tasks should not be children of a Web Application Pool, since it could be reset by IIS at any time. Searching for a solution, I read a bit about Quartz.Net, but most examples are talking about recurring jobs. I was wondering if it were also appropriate for tasks that should run only once when a user asks for it. Or is there another better solution?
Also, if Quartz.Net is a good way to go, should it run as a Windows Service, or should it be spawned by the ASP.Net web site using Global.asax?
Quartz.net works just fine for this scenario. You schedule a one time job on Quartz.net and let it run for as long as it needs to. At work this is exactly how we run many of our jobs.
You should set up Quartz.Net as a windows service though. IIS recycles web apps and if you run Quartz.net within your web app it will get recycled along with you web app by IIS.
